Here is a bit of a list of a couple of things i have done to it.

95 mod. VR series 2
3.8 V6 manual(blue), Vr clubsport body kit with GTS wing and painted rear reflector strip, 17 inch VR GTS wheels with dunlop rubber, pacemaker headers into lukey 2.5inch cat back exhaust. CAI with KN pannel filter, top gun 8mm leads. Boge shockies and new bushes and swaybar. Blue vision lights and blue dash lights, debadged and then rebadged. Sony head unit, 6 inch front speakers and 6x9 pioneer rears two 222w amps and 10 inch sony xplod sub. Tinted tail lights, colour coded dash, airhorns :p and a working power mirror light.
